The Office exists
To assist pastors and parish staffs to develop and
implement ministries at the parish and diocesan level
that seek to fully integrate persons with disabilities
and/or illnesses, into the everyday faith life of the
Roman Catholic Community.
The goals of the office are:
- To provide workshops and sensitivity training for parishes, schools and other diocesan organizations
- To provide assistance to parishes and parish staffs in program assessment, planning, implementation and evaluation.
- To provide specialized liturgies and retreats.

Beatitudes for Friends and Family
Blessed are you who take time to listen to
difficult speech, for you help us perservere until we
are understood.
Blessed are you who walk with us in public places and ignore
the stare of strangers, for we find havens of relaxation
in your companionship.
Blessed are you who never bid us to "hurry up" and more
blessed are you who do not snatch tasks from our
hands to do them for us, for ofthen we need time rather
than help.
Blessed are you who stand beside us as we enter new and untried
ventures for the delight we feel when we surprise you
outweighs all frustrating failures.
Blessed are you who ask for our help, for our greatest
need is to be needed.
(Author Unknown)
